Instructions
Mash bananas with the back of a fork (it doesn't matter if it's not smooth).
In a large mixing bowl, mix together mashed bananas, sourdough starter, milk and eggs until well combined.
Pour in the melted butter and stir through the starter mixture.
In a separate bowl, mix together flour salt, baking powder and sugar.
Now pour the liquid ingredients into the dry ingredients.
Mix until it forms a pourable batter.
Heat up your waffle iron and spoon mixture into the iron. Cook to your liking (these waffles are delicious soft or crispy).
Notes
Milk or buttermilk - you can use either milk or buttermilk in these sourdough waffles. If you make your own butter or cultured butter, you will have plenty of buttermilk on hand. This is perfect to include in this recipe.
